WebAcidophilus is a bacteria naturally found in your body. Your mouth, stomach, intestines, lungs, vagina and urinary tract all contain acidophilus. Your body uses acidophilus to break down food and absorb nutrients. Acidophilus is considered a “good” bacteria. Your body needs good bacteria to support your immune system and digestive system. WebJan 2, 2014 · The package labeling on probiotic supplements is often confusing. Sometimes the consumer is instructed to take the probiotics with meals, sometimes before or after … WebMay 30, 2024 · Based on stomach physiology, it is best to take probiotics on an empty stomach when the acid level is low. The other time to consider taking the probiotic is during the early phase of a meal. Although there is an increase in acid production, the food will buffer the acid and increase motility, which allows the probiotic to empty sooner into the ...
